Ensure Authenticity and Original Ownership

Always verify that you legally own the device and that it is genuine. Reselling stolen or counterfeit devices can lead to criminal charges and financial penalties. Keep proof of purchase and any relevant documentation to demonstrate your ownership.

Tips for Verifying Ownership

  • Request original purchase receipts.
  • Check the device’s IMEI number against official databases.
  • Ensure the device is not reported stolen or lost.

Draft Clear Sales Agreements

A written agreement protects both parties and clarifies the terms of sale. Include details such as the device’s condition, warranty status, payment terms, and any return policies. This documentation can be invaluable if disputes arise.

Key Elements of a Sales Agreement

  • Device description and condition
  • Price and payment method
  • Warranty and return policies
  • Liability disclaimers

Fair Payment Practices

To ensure you get paid fairly, use secure payment methods such as PayPal, escrow services, or bank transfers. Avoid accepting cheques or cash in person without proper verification, as these can be risky or lead to disputes.

Protect Yourself During Transactions

  • Use traceable payment methods.
  • Keep records of all communications and transactions.
  • Confirm receipt of payment before shipping the device.

When listing your Pixel 8 online, include accurate descriptions to avoid misleading buyers. When shipping, comply with export laws and customs regulations to prevent legal issues in international sales.

Tips for Safe Listing and Shipping

  • Provide detailed, honest descriptions and photos.
  • Use tracked and insured shipping methods.
  • Declare the correct value and contents on customs forms.
